The factory limited warranty is 3yrs/36,000 miles which covers nearly everything. The powertrain warranty (engine, trans, driveshaft, diff, axles) is 5yrs/60,000 miles.

Intake and exhaust should not void the warranty, but it might help to get friendly with your service advisor so that they'll go to bat for you just in case something does indeed go wrong. Keep your stock parts just in case you need to put them back on.

I ordered mine at Hatfield Subaru in Columbus in the middle of March, I was #3 on their list of 12 cars they had allotted IIRC. Came in the last weekend in June. Ordered mine in DGM because I like gray cars and they are easy to keep looking clean. No CEL or any other issues with mine. Mine will never see salty or snowy roads in the winter. I'll only take it out of the garage between November and March if the temps are above 45° and the roads are completely clear of all salt and other winter crap. If you need to drive it year round in Ohio, get a 2nd set of wheels with snow tires, and make sure to thoroughly wash off all of the salt and winter grime at least every week or two, especially underneath.
